Pan fried peaches Recipe

Pan-fried peaches are a delightful and simple dessert that brings out the natural sweetness of the fruit. The caramelized exterior paired with warm, tender peach flesh is a heavenly combination. This quick recipe is perfect for a sweet treat anytime.

Ingredients

Scale

Fresh Peaches:

  • 4 fresh peaches

Seasoning:

  • 1 tablespoon unsalted butter
  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ar (adjust to taste)
  • ½ teaspoon cinnamon powder
  • ¼ teaspoon ginger powder
  • A pinch of salt

Instructions

  1. Cut and Prep: Cut each peach into half, vertically. Remove the seed.
  2. Melt Butter and Season: Melt butter in a pan. Add brown sugar, cinnamon, ginger, and salt. Mix well.
  3. Cook Peaches: Place the peaches in the pan with the cut side down. Cook for 5-7 minutes until caramelized.
  4. Flip and Finish: Gently turn the peaches and cook the other side for 2-3 minutes.
  5. Serve: Enjoy hot with ice cream, yogurt, pancakes, or your favorite accompaniment.

Notes

  • You can customize the seasoning to your taste preferences.
  • Ensure the peaches are ripe but firm for the best results.
